IIT Bombay opens applications for Advanced Cybersecurity & Software Development Courses

Applications open till 31 December.

Somya Agarwal

The Indian Institute of Technology Bombay (IIT Bombay) has announced the second edition of its Professional Certification Programmes in Cybersecurity and Software Development. The courses are offered through the IIT-B Trust Lab, Department of Computer Science and Engineering. Each runs entirely online over 12 months and includes three structured courses taught by IIT Bombay faculty.

New additions to the curriculum

This edition introduces two new 14-week modules:

  • Network Security (Cybersecurity Programme) – focusing on protecting computer networks from evolving cyber threats through applied learning in defence strategies, secure protocols, and network hardening.

  • Full-Stack MERN Development with Apache and Nginx (Software Development Programme) – training participants to design, build, and deploy secure, scalable web applications using modern frameworks and server configurations.

According to IIT Bombay, the courses are carefully curated to keep pace with current market needs, enhancing professional growth and opening diverse career opportunities in high-demand technology sectors.

Important dates

  • Programme start date: January 4, 2026

  • Application deadline: December 31, 2025
